We are proud to share that our school has been recognised among the Top 100 Private Primary Schools in South Australia, placing 36th overall! This honour is a great endorsement of the incredible work across our entire community — our leadership team, teachers, support staff, students, and families who together create a vibrant environment focused on learning, wellbeing, and connection.

The recognition is based on a range of important measures, including NAPLAN results, student attendance, class sizes, and community demographics, highlighting our strong commitment to both academic excellence and student engagement.

Aerobics Team Success!
Our School Aerobics teams performed brilliantly over the weekend at the FISAF Australia Super Series event. These events provide Australian athletes with a fantastic opportunity to compete and receive valuable written judge feedback ahead of the upcoming State Championships, and our teams certainly made the most of it! A huge congratulations to Katie, Carisa and Chloe on their guidance and support of our talented students, and to our incredible teams for their outstanding achievements:

Tic Tacs – 1st Place
Limitless Legends – 1st Place
The Movers – 3rd Place

We are so proud of your hard work, teamwork and dedication. An amazing effort, Congratulations to all our dedicated TWCS competitors.

This morning, our PACE Committee hosted Mother’s Day Breakfast to celebrate the incredible mums and mother figures in our school community. Families gathered to enjoy delicious pastries, students enjoyed hot chocolates, and the coffee van was once again a crowd favourite! Thank you to our Aerobics Teams for the special performances, it was a joy to see them perform with such enthusiasm. Celebrations continued with a heartfelt Mother’s Day Liturgy led by our reception classes, reminding us all of the love, care, and strength our mums show every day. As the first community event organised under the new PACE model, we are grateful to everyone who contributed to making the morning such a welcoming and memorable occasion

Our House Leaders recently attended the SACPSSA Students Leadership Conference at St Michaels College. TWCS Leaders worked with students from other Catholic Schools to learn about Leadership in schools and how they can use PE to improve their skills and continue be a positive role model in our community. They will use these skills and knowledge to implement activities through the rest of the year.
